La Gazzetta Dello Sport reports that Inter value Chelsea and Manchester United target Denzel Dumfries at €60m and could use the proceeds of his sale to buy Atalanta‘s Giorgio Scalvini.

Dumfries, 26, joined Inter in a €14m deal from PSV in 2021, replacing Achraf Hakimi, who had signed for PSG for €68m plus add-ons.

Dumfries’ seven goals and ten assists in 65 appearances across all competitions with the Nerazzurri have attracted interest from Chelsea and Manchester United, and according to Gazzetta, the Serie A giants have already informed the Premier League pair that the Netherlands international will be available for €60m next summer.

Atalanta’s Giorgio Scalvini is seen as a potential replacement for Dumfries even if the soon-to-be 19-year-old is not a right wing-back and can play in a three-man defence or central midfield.

Atalanta value the Italian wonderkid at €40m, a fee Inter can’t afford without selling one of their most valuable assets.

The Nerazzurri will offer contract extensions to Milan Skriniar, Matteo Darmian, Edin Dzeko and Alex Cordaz. At the same time, Roberto Gagliardini, Stefan de Vrij, Danilo D’Ambrosio and Samir Handanovic could leave at the end of their deals in June.

Therefore, Darmian would become Dumfries’ replacement while Scalvini would bolster Simone Inzaghi’s options in defence, especially if D’Ambrosio and De Vrij leave.
